Lined with palm trees along the Southern California coastline, Ventura Oceanfront boardwalk serves as the race start and finish line area for the Surfers Point Marathon which is set to make its annual running in mid-November on a course that will serve as a Boston Marathon qualifying race.
The course is very flat and walker-friendly, organizers say, adding that it features a 7-hour course time limit for the full marathon. Most of the race takes place either within shouting distance of the beachfront or along the beachfront boardwalk itself, as the race will start overlooking the waves crashing along the shoreline of Promenade Park, which lies just down the beach from Surfer’s Point Park and the Ventura County Fairgrounds.
Course highlights
Two loop Full marathon course, start / finish will be at beautiful Ventura Oceanfront boardwalk adjacent to Surfers Point beach.
Start at Promenade park, head north along the boardwalk and onto the bike path, bike path leads you onto HWY-1 beachfront bike path. All runners will stay on the bike path or shoulder (ocean side) of Highway 1 along the route. turn around at the designated turnaround point at approx 5.13 mile mark and back towards the finish line, PASS THE FINISH LINE, continue south (towards the pier) along the boardwalk turn left at state beach park circle bike path along the outer edge of the park that takes you back onto the boardwalk headed north again, back to the beachfront boardwalk and bike path to the finish line. START YOUR SECOND LOOP.
